如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

WebSphere面试问题全解析:助你轻松应对面试

WebSphere面试问题全解析:助你轻松应对面试

在当今的IT行业中,WebSphere作为IBM的一款强大中间件产品,广泛应用于企业级应用的开发和部署。无论你是初入职场的应届生,还是经验丰富的IT专业人士,了解WebSphere面试问题都是非常必要的。本文将为大家详细介绍WebSphere面试问题,并列举一些常见的应用场景,帮助你更好地准备面试。

WebSphere简介

WebSphere是IBM公司推出的一系列软件产品,主要用于构建、运行和管理企业级应用。它包括了应用服务器、交易服务器、门户服务器等多种组件,支持Java EE(Java Platform, Enterprise Edition)标准。WebSphere的强大之处在于其高可用性、可扩展性和安全性,使其成为许多大型企业的首选应用服务器。

常见的WebSphere面试问题

  1. 什么是WebSphere Application Server?

    • WebSphere Application Server(WAS)是IBM提供的一个Java EE应用服务器,用于托管和运行Java EE应用程序。它支持多种操作系统和数据库,提供高性能的应用部署环境。
  2. WebSphere的架构是什么样的?

    • WebSphere的架构包括客户端、Web服务器插件、应用服务器、数据库服务器等。它的核心是应用服务器,负责处理HTTP请求、管理事务、提供安全性等。
  3. 如何配置WebSphere的安全性?

    • WebSphere提供了多种安全配置选项,包括用户认证、SSL/TLS加密、单点登录(SSO)等。面试时,你可能需要解释如何设置这些安全特性。
  4. WebSphere的集群和负载均衡如何实现?

    • WebSphere支持集群技术,通过多个服务器实例来提高系统的可用性和性能。负载均衡可以通过WebSphere的内置负载均衡器或外部负载均衡设备来实现。
  5. 如何进行WebSphere的性能调优?

    • 性能调优涉及到JVM设置、数据库连接池配置、线程池管理等方面。面试官可能会问到具体的调优策略和工具。

WebSphere的应用场景

  • 电子商务平台:WebSphere常用于构建高可用性和高性能的电子商务网站,处理大量的并发用户请求。
  • 金融服务:银行、保险公司等金融机构利用WebSphere来确保交易的安全性和可靠性。
  • 企业内部应用:许多企业使用WebSphere来开发和部署内部的ERP、CRM等系统,确保数据的安全和系统的稳定性。
  • 政府和公共服务:政府部门利用WebSphere来提供公共服务的在线平台,确保服务的连续性和数据的安全。

准备WebSphere面试的建议

  1. 深入学习WebSphere的基本概念和架构:了解其组件、安装、配置和管理。

  2. 实践操作:在虚拟机或云环境中安装和配置WebSphere,尝试部署一些简单的应用。

  3. 了解常见问题和解决方案:熟悉WebSphere常见的性能问题、安全配置、集群管理等。

  4. 准备技术面试题:除了理论知识,还要准备一些实际操作问题,如如何配置JVM参数、如何进行故障排查等。

  5. 关注最新版本和更新:WebSphere不断更新,了解最新版本的特性和改进。

通过以上内容的学习和准备,你将能够在WebSphere面试中展现出你的专业知识和实际操作能力。记住,理论与实践相结合是面试成功的关键。希望这篇文章能为你提供有价值的信息,助你在面试中脱颖而出。